FAQs - booking Baltimore flights

  • How far is Baltimore/Washington Airport from central Baltimore?

    You’ll need to travel 14 km to reach the Baltimore city centre from Baltimore/Washington Airport.

  • What is the name of Baltimore’s airport?

    All flights to Baltimore land at Baltimore/Washington Airport. The airport code is BWI,and it can also be referred to as Baltimore Washington Intl, Baltimore/Washington, or Baltimore/Washington Intl Thurgood Marshall.
